Scott Tetlow

Born in Rochdale in 1969, Scott developed a passion for art as a young boy. During his late teens Scott spent his free time sketching punks and designing album covers. It was this body of work that earned him a place at Cheltenham University, where he gained his fine art degree.

In 2002, his much-loved studio burnt to the ground and he lost everything. Unable to continue both practically and emotionally, Scott threw himself into teaching, believing that his art career was now just part of his past.

In 2011, Scott moved his family to Verona and, ironically, moved into an apartment directly above an art shop. Feeling inspired to pick up his brushes once again, he began to draw the stunning architecture. With his passion rekindled, he returned to England and built a studio in his garden. He hasn’t stopped painting since.

Distinctive of the urban pop movement, Scott’s style is innovative and instantly recognisable and was born out of his studies of calligraphy in Taiwan. His journey of drawing chimps also began many years ago, and his iconic chimp character came into being when he was creating a body of work called ‘Emerging Figures.’ In one piece he couldn’t see any human figures emerging, only a chimp, and eventually he gave in and painted the chimp that he could see! From that point, it has become a regular feature of the Tetlow portfolio.

“Every single line on each of my drawings is inspired by a living object, the result being that every line has the energy of a living thing.”
